Waxing and skin sensitivity

Wax depilation removes hair from the roots, leaving the skin smooth for a longer period of time. However, the treatment causes mechanical irritation of the epidermis, making the skin more sensitive, red and prone to damage. Hair removal can also damage the skin's natural protective barrier, making it more susceptible to UV rays.

Tanning after wax depilation - is it safe?

Immediately after waxing depilation, sunbathing is not recommended. The skin is then particularly delicate and prone to irritation. Sunbathing in this situation can lead to a number of undesirable effects. The body is more susceptible to sunburn after wax depilation, increasing the risk of severe redness and pain even after a short exposure to the sun. In addition, sunbathing with irritated skin can lead to permanent discolouration and increase irritation, itching and inflammation. The same side effects may occur when freshly depilated skin is exposed to the light in a tanning bed.

How long should I avoid the sun after depilation?

After wax depilation, it is recommended to avoid direct sun exposure for a minimum of 24-48 hours, and up to 72 hours for more sensitive skin. During this time, the skin has a chance to regenerate and the irritation will soften. Only after this period can you consider sunbathing, but always with appropriate sun protection - whether by using sunscreen or ensuring appropriate protective clothing.

How do I protect my skin after waxing?

  • Using a cream with UV protection - even a few days after depilation, the skin may be more sensitive, so always apply a cream with a high SPF (minimum 30 and preferably 50).
  • Avoiding prolonged sun exposure - despite using sunscreen, it is a good idea to limit the time you spend in the sun, especially during peak sunlight hours, i.e. between 10am and 4pm.
  • Moisturise your skin - after depilation, your skin needs intensive moisturisation. Using soothing lotions or gels with aloe vera will help keep the skin moisturised and speed up its recovery.
  • Wearing loose clothing - immediately after depilation, it's a good idea to wear loose, airy clothing made from natural fabrics that won't irritate sensitive skin.
